What is understanding inheritance - web?
Understanding inheritance - web is a concept in programming where a subclass (or child class) inherits attributes and behaviors from a superclass (or parent class).

What is the purpose of understanding inheritance - web?
The purpose of understanding inheritance in web development is to promote code reusability and to establish hierarchical relationships between classes for better organization and structure.
